We are looking for a Portfolio Risk Manager.

We’re launching a new business line in Mexico and looking for a strong leader to own credit risk end-to-end. You’ll set the risk vision, design frameworks, build and lead the team, and ensure sustainable portfolio growth while keeping losses under control.

Day-to-day responsibilities:

  • Build from scratch: design credit origination policy, limit setting, pricing guardrails, early-warning triggers, and collections feedback loops
  • Own risk metrics: manage risk appetite and ensure portfolio performance stays within it; maintain live dashboards and explain drivers of metric changes
  • Portfolio analytics: perform segmentation, stress-testing, cohort analysis, and vintage tracking
  • Team leadership: recruit, mentor, and develop analysts; foster a data-driven and experimentation-focused culture
  • Cross-functional collaboration: embed risk controls in product specifications, customer journeys, and work closely with finance and 2nd line of defence teams

The ideal candidate:

  • 3+ years in product management or credit risk management focused on retail or consumer lending portfolios (banking or fintech)
  • Strong understanding of scorecard design, ML techniques, and alternative data for credit decisioning
  • Proficient in SQL and Python/R with hands-on experience working with data
  • Proven leadership experience — managed teams, set OKRs, and developed analysts
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Economics, Engineering, or Mathematics; MBA or CFA is a plus
  • Strong technical or quantitative background with a strategic mindset
  • B1 or higher English level for effective communication with an international team

Working in Mexico

Mexico, officially the United Mexican States, is a country in North America. It is the northernmost country in Latin America and borders the United States of America to the north, and Guatemala and Belize to the southeast; while having maritime boundaries with the Pacific Ocean to the west, the Caribbean Sea to the southeast, and the Gulf of Mexico to the east. Mexico covers 1,972,550 km2, and is the thirteenth-largest country in the world by land area.
